Muir delivers greater transparency for planning decisions

North Down Alliance Councillor Andrew Muir has delivered key changes in how planning applications will be dealt with when powers are transferred to the new Council from the Environment Department in April. The local Council put an end to anonymous voting on planning issues, with Councillors unanimously agreeing to record decisions on all planning decisions. […]
